Top local museum in the former market square weighing house. It presents the Peace of Westphalia and Osnabrück’s urban history in a central historic setting.
Important collection focused on painter Felix Nussbaum, designed by Daniel Libeskind. Powerful architecture and art make it a standout cultural stop.
Compact museum on the Erich Maria Remarque peace center. It explores the author’s life, anti-war themes, and literary legacy in a meaningful setting.
Historic market square framed by the town hall and St. Mary’s Church. It is the classic starting point for exploring Osnabrück’s old town atmosphere.
One of the city’s oldest streets, lined with restored houses and small shops. It captures the medieval character of central Osnabrück.
Pedestrian street in the old town with handsome façades and independent businesses. Popular for strolling between major historic sights.
Grünkohl cooked with onions and spices, usually served in winter with potatoes and sausage. A classic North German comfort dish also popular in Osnabrück.
Hearty kale and barley stew from Lower Saxony, often enriched with smoked meat. It reflects the region's rural winter cooking traditions.
Pan-fried potatoes with onions and bacon, often served with fried eggs or pickles. A staple pub and home dish across northwest Germany.

Moderate for Germany. Hotels and dining are usually cheaper than in Munich or Hamburg, while local transit and everyday costs stay manageable for most visitors.
Service is usually included. Round up or add about 5-10% in restaurants. Round up small taxi fares and leave small change at cafes.
